NDI to ADD RADAR for Critical Test Results Management
Beachwood, Ohio, May 9, 2008NDI is
implementing a new critical test results management
solution, RADAR Medical Systems, with a version
specifically designed for teleradiology. "We're excited
to introduce our solution to NDI," stated RADAR CEO Jack
C. Cornell. "RADAR provides a fail-safe system to close
the loop when critical results are communicated to
referring physicians in a radiology environment,"
Cornell added.
Location specific workflow empowers teleradiologists to flag studies with a
critical test result. Automatic distribution of emails and text messages to
clients expedites the communication process. "This represents NDI's continuing
efforts to explore new technologies so that we can deliver the best service
possible to our clients," said NDI President & CEO Dr. David H. Berns.

RADAR's basic system offers an enterprise-wide CTRM (Critical Test Result
Management) solution for radiology, laboratory, cardiology, ED, etc. providing
automatic alert creation through its HL7 interface engine. By using Microsoft
.Net 2.0 and SQL server platforms, RADAR can be integrated in virtually any
healthcare enterprise, offering a very powerful system to support CTRM as well
other applications in QA, risk management, peer review and practice management.
